Bachelor of Science in Energy Technology
The Bachelor of Science in Energy Technology is a undergraduate programme offered by Kenyan universities, designed to provide advanced training and research opportunities in energy studies and sustainable energy. The programme is accredited by the Commission for University Education (CUE) and delivered through coursework, seminars, and independent research.
Students engage with renewable energy, energy policy, energy economics, and sustainable technologies through a structured curriculum that combines theoretical foundations with practical applications. The programme emphasises clean energy transition, energy access, and sustainability and prepares scholars to contribute original research to the discipline.
Kenya's Kenya is expanding renewable energy including geothermal, solar, and wind power. The programme addresses national development priorities and aligns with Kenya's Vision 2030, which emphasises the need for highly trained professionals in energy and sustainability. Graduates are equipped to tackle complex challenges facing the country and the East African region.
